Are you leading a company that’s growing faster than its culture can keep up? In this episode, Fractional COO Tim Peterson flips the script on leadership, arguing that culture doesn’t necessarily start at the top. He shares how successful organizations evolve by listening to their people, embracing change, and keeping curiosity alive even through chaos. From 130-year-old global brands to the unpredictable energy of LinkedIn debates, Tim explores how openness and authenticity fuel growth that lasts.
